Detailed Description

Enhance your wiring projects with our Ultra-Fast 250 Asy Tab connectors, designed for seamless efficiency. Crafted from durable brass with a protective tin plating, these tabs ensure reliable conductivity. The vibrant blue color signifies easy identification, while the nylon insulation guarantees safety. With a straight orientation and a secure F-Crimp design, they accommodate 14-16 AWG wires, making them ideal for a wide range of applications. Operating flawlessly in temperatures ranging from -40 to 110°C (-40 to 230°F), these tabs are not only dependable but also versatile.
